What is the name of your state (only U.S. law)? Nj
My husband and I have been married for 3 years, but he bought the home we are currently living in while we were just dating. The deed and mortgage do not have my name on them, just his. I do not expect anything to happen to my husband anytime soon, but I am concerned that if something were to happen to him and my name is not on the deed, what happens to the house? He has two adult children, my relationship is good with one, and rocky with the other. Where do I stand with the home?What is the name of your state (only U.S. law)?

Absent survivorship rights on the deed or a quite explicit will the laws of intestate succession apply. That typically means that you get half and the children get half.

The deed can be readily altered to joint tenancy with right of survivorship.

There's no overriding need to change the mortgage. Even if he were to die, if the deed conveyed to you, you could continue paying on the mortgage as if you were listed on it.

and he could also write a will that would direct the house to you. I am sure there are other items he would like you to have as well and the only way to be certain you get those items, he must list them in the will. If he wants something specific to go to either of his sons, he would utilize a will for that as well.

Option three: he could leave you a life estate, allowing you to remain, but granting ownership to his kids, to become fully theirs after your death.
